PIMCO Enhanced Low Duration Active Exchange-Traded Fund

190 hedge funds and large institutions have $1.17B invested in PIMCO Enhanced Low Duration Active Exchange-Traded Fund in 2026 Q1 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 44 funds opening new positions, 87 increasing their positions, 42 reducing their positions, and 14 closing their positions.
